The Oxford County Injury Prevention Team wants to see kids bundle up and take part in Winter Walk Day
WOODSTOCK - The Oxford County Injury Prevention Team wants to see even more kids heel toe-ing it to school.
Public Health Nurse Kelly Vanderhoeven says the Injury Prevention Team is supporting Winter Walk Day on February 1st.
"Students are being encouraged to walk to school even moreso on just this one day and we will be celebrating with the students who do make it to school in the morning."
Members of the Injury Prevention Team will be meeting kids as they arrive at Southside Public school and celebrating their healthy choices.
"We're celebrating it at Southside because they have a School Travel Plan Initiative happening there. They are the only school in Oxford County that has a School Travel Plan Committee."
The day also includes a poster contest and a Safety Expo in the gym.
